Hi Ron
Been doing this all year .
It is a 14.8 volt on a hangar nine starter.
Of course you don.t run your starter very long anyways . It sure beats the 12 volt gel cells and I only charge every so often. Also it is a good use of your older poly's.

Hi Ron: I use a 3 cell lipo on mine and there is plenty of power.  It's a 2200ma 30C cell and gives much more tourqe than the standard 12V gel cell.  Not sure about a 4 cell; but , I can't see it being much of problem for a heavy duty starter.
